Russia declared a ceasefire in Ukraine's capital city Kyiv and three other cities - Mariupol, Kharkiv and Sumy - on Monday, Russian Defense Ministry said in a statement.
Report informs that, according to the statement, taking into account the catastrophic humanitarian situation and its sharp aggravation in Kyiv, Kharkiv, Sumy and Mariupol, as well as at the personal request of the President of the French Republic Emmanuel Macron to the President of the Russian Federation Vladimir Putin, the Russian Armed Forces for humanitarian purposes, on March 7, from 10:00 am establish cease-fire and open humanitarian corridors.
